c oracle 去重复

2023年 8月 3日 29.0k 0

int newArr[9];
int newIndex = 0;
for (int i = 0; i

上述代码中,我们使用了一个flag变量来判断当前元素是否已经在新数组中出现过。如果出现过,则将flag设为0,并跳出内层循环;否则,将当前元素添加到新数组中,并将newIndex加1,方便下次添加元素。

接下来我们来看看Oracle数据库中的去重操作。假设我们有一张学生信息表,其中可能存在重复记录。我们可以使用Oracle内置的DISTINCT关键字来去重。具体来说,我们可以使用SELECT语句来查询所有不重复的记录,如下所示。

SELECT DISTINCT * FROM student;

上述SQL语句中,我们使用DISTINCT关键字来查询所有不重复的记录,并使用*表示查询所有列的数据。通过这样的操作,我们可以很方便地完成对表中数据的去重操作,从而提高数据处理效率。

在开发过程中,我们经常会遇到需要对数据进行去重的情况,无论是使用C语言还是Oracle数据库,我们都可以采用不同的方法来完成去重操作。通过本文的讲解,相信你已经掌握了去重的基本方法和技巧,可以在以后的开发中轻松应对去重的需求。

相关文章

Oracle如何使用授予和撤销权限的语法和示例
Awesome Project: 探索 MatrixOrigin 云原生分布式数据库
下载丨66页PDF,云和恩墨技术通讯(2024年7月刊)
社区版oceanbase安装
Oracle 导出CSV工具-sqluldr2
ETL数据集成丨快速将MySQL数据迁移至Doris数据库

发布评论